WebMay 4, 2024 · For this reason, we deployed audio-magnetotelluric (AMT) sounding in the research area, collected 26 profiles and 1198 measuring points, carried out 3D inversion calculations of off-diagonal elements in the impedance tensor data using the nonlinear conjugate gradient method, and obtained a 3D electrical structure model. Magnetotellurics (MT) is an electromagnetic geophysical method for inferring the earth's subsurface electrical conductivity from measurements of natural geomagnetic and geoelectric field variation at the Earth's surface.
